Abstract

The challenges with which municipalities are currently faced, include the fulfilment of the expectations of many new communities to whom they must render services, while they must simultaneously improve the quality of existing services and eliminate backlogs. The sources from which local authorities generate their revenue at present do not appear to be adequate for the increased need for funds. 
This paper provides an overview of the issues that have led to the current state of municipal finances and the factors that influence the revenue and expenditure of municipalities. In the light of the lack of sources of income for municipalities, particular attention is given to issues which could have an effect on the improvement of administration in municipalities.
